About Nigerian Army’s Workforce

Nigerian Army is an Aerospace and Defense company that employs 5,131 people worldwide as of March 2026. It is the 6th-largest by headcount among its peers. Founded in 1960, the company is headquartered in Abuja, Nigeria.

Nigerian Army's workforce has declined 1.7% from 2023 to 2026, down 0.8% year over year in 2026. Its workforce is concentrated most in Sub-Saharan Africa (98.2%), followed by North America (0.6%) and Northern Europe (0.5%).

Nigerian Army's functional groups are Finance and Operations (72.7%), Engineering (16.3%), and Sales and Marketing (11.0%). The average salary is $9,919, ranging from a median of $60,000 in Northern Europe to $8,000 in Sub-Saharan Africa.

Nigerian Army's active job postings rose 200.0% in 2026 to 2, with new postings per month climbing from 0 in 2023 to 1 in 2026. Overall employee sentiment is neutral but improving.
